Skip to main content

Structured query language

Di era digital seperti sekarang, data adalah aset berharga. Mulai dari aplikasi media sosial, e-commerce, hingga layanan streaming, semuanya bergantung pada data untuk memberikan pengalaman terbaik kepada pengguna. Nah, inilah peran SQL (Structured Query Language) yang menjadi alat utama dalam pengelolaan data di database.

SQL adalah bahasa standar yang digunakan untuk berinteraksi dengan database relasional. Dengan SQL, kita bisa membuat, mengelola, mencari, atau memodifikasi data dalam database secara cepat dan efisien. Mari kita bahas lebih dalam tentang bagaimana SQL bekerja dan mengapa penting untuk dikuasai, terutama bagi yang ingin berkarier di bidang teknologi.

Mengapa SQL Sangat Penting?

Sederhananya, SQL membantu kita "berbicara" dengan database. Bayangkan, dalam sebuah aplikasi e-commerce, ribuan transaksi terjadi setiap detik. SQL memungkinkan sistem untuk memproses data ini dengan cepat, seperti menambah produk ke katalog, menyimpan pesanan pelanggan, atau menampilkan rekomendasi produk berdasarkan riwayat pembelian.

Berikut adalah beberapa peran penting SQL di dunia teknologi:

  1. Pengelolaan Data yang Efisien – SQL memungkinkan kita untuk menyimpan, memperbarui, dan menghapus data dengan cepat.
  2. Kemampuan Analisis – SQL dapat digunakan untuk menganalisis data, misalnya, menghitung rata-rata penjualan harian atau mengidentifikasi tren pembelian.
  3. Keamanan dan Privasi – SQL juga mendukung fitur keamanan, memungkinkan administrator untuk mengatur siapa saja yang bisa mengakses data tertentu.

Fungsi-Fungsi Dasar dalam SQL

  1. SELECT
    Fungsi paling dasar dalam SQL adalah SELECT, yang digunakan untuk mengambil data dari tabel. Misalnya, jika kita memiliki database pelanggan, SELECT bisa membantu kita menampilkan semua nama pelanggan.

    sql

    SELECT nama FROM pelanggan;
  2. INSERT INTO
    Saat kita ingin menambahkan data baru, kita menggunakan INSERT INTO. Misalnya, kita ingin memasukkan data pelanggan baru ke dalam tabel.

    sql

    INSERT INTO pelanggan (nama, alamat) VALUES ('John Doe', 'Jl. Mawar 123');
  3. UPDATE
    UPDATE digunakan ketika kita ingin memperbarui data yang sudah ada. Misalnya, jika ada kesalahan pada alamat pelanggan, kita bisa memperbaruinya.

    sql

    UPDATE pelanggan SET alamat = 'Jl. Melati 456' WHERE nama = 'John Doe';
  4. DELETE
    Untuk menghapus data, kita bisa menggunakan DELETE. Hati-hati, karena data yang dihapus dengan perintah ini tidak bisa dikembalikan.

    sql

    DELETE FROM pelanggan WHERE nama = 'John Doe';
  5. JOIN
    Salah satu fitur yang membuat SQL sangat kuat adalah kemampuannya untuk menghubungkan beberapa tabel dengan perintah JOIN. Misalnya, jika kita punya tabel "pesanan" dan "pelanggan," kita bisa menghubungkannya untuk melihat data pesanan setiap pelanggan.

    sql

    SELECT pelanggan.nama, pesanan.tanggal
    FROM pelanggan
    JOIN pesanan ON pelanggan.id = pesanan.pelanggan_id;

Aplikasi SQL di Dunia Nyata

SQL digunakan hampir di semua industri yang memanfaatkan data, mulai dari layanan perbankan hingga media sosial. Berikut adalah beberapa aplikasi SQL di dunia nyata:

  • Perbankan: Bank menggunakan SQL untuk melacak semua transaksi, saldo, dan data nasabah.
  • E-commerce: Layanan e-commerce seperti Amazon dan Tokopedia menggunakan SQL untuk mengelola katalog produk, pesanan pelanggan, dan analisis penjualan.
  • Media Sosial: Platform seperti Instagram dan Facebook menggunakan SQL untuk menyimpan data pengguna, riwayat aktivitas, dan informasi lainnya.

Mengapa Belajar SQL?

Untuk karier di bidang teknologi, SQL adalah keterampilan dasar yang banyak dibutuhkan. Bahkan jika Anda bukan seorang database administrator, memiliki pengetahuan dasar SQL bisa sangat membantu, terutama jika Anda bekerja di bidang data analysis, software engineering, atau bahkan marketing yang berbasis data.

Beberapa alasan untuk belajar SQL antara lain:

  1. Meningkatkan Efisiensi – Dengan SQL, Anda bisa mengambil atau menganalisis data dalam jumlah besar dengan cepat.
  2. Dapat Diterapkan di Berbagai Peran – SQL adalah bahasa universal yang digunakan di banyak bidang.
  3. Menambah Nilai Karier – Kemampuan SQL adalah salah satu keterampilan yang banyak dicari oleh perusahaan, terutama di dunia yang semakin data-driven.

Kesimpulan

SQL adalah bahasa yang esensial dalam dunia pengelolaan data. Dengan kemampuannya untuk memudahkan interaksi dengan database, SQL membantu perusahaan dan individu untuk mengelola data dengan lebih baik. Menguasai SQL adalah langkah penting bagi siapa saja yang ingin berkarier di bidang teknologi, karena bahasa ini tidak hanya efisien tetapi juga mudah dipelajari dan sangat serbaguna.

Jika Anda tertarik untuk belajar SQL, banyak platform online yang menyediakan latihan SQL secara gratis. Mulailah dengan perintah-perintah dasar, dan perlahan tingkatkan pemahaman Anda dengan mencoba latihan di database dummy atau studi kasus yang relevan dengan minat Anda.

Comments

Popular posts from this blog

Teknologi Informasi

Teknologi Informasi atau sering disebut IT (Information Technology) , adalah penggunaan komputer, perangkat keras, dan perangkat lunak untuk memproses, menyimpan, serta mengelola data dan informasi. Peran IT dalam kehidupan kita sangat besar, mulai dari kebutuhan sehari-hari hingga operasional bisnis. 1. Apa Itu Infrastruktur IT? Infrastruktur IT adalah fondasi utama yang memungkinkan sistem bekerja dengan baik. Terdiri dari beberapa komponen utama, yaitu: Perangkat Keras (Hardware): Seperti komputer, server, jaringan, yang berfungsi menjalankan dan menyimpan data. Perangkat Lunak (Software): Program atau aplikasi yang menjalankan instruksi, seperti sistem operasi, aplikasi bisnis, dan lainnya. Jaringan (Network): Menghubungkan perangkat dan memungkinkan komunikasi serta berbagi data antar perangkat. 2. IT Service Management (Manajemen Layanan IT) Ini adalah pengelolaan layanan IT untuk memastikan layanan tersebut berjalan dengan efisien dan efektif. Proses utamanya adalah memastik...

Cloud Computing

Di era digital yang serba cepat ini, teknologi terus berkembang dengan pesat. Salah satu inovasi terbesar dalam dunia teknologi informasi adalah cloud computing atau komputasi awan. Konsep ini telah membawa perubahan besar dalam cara kita menyimpan data, mengelola aplikasi, dan menjalankan berbagai kegiatan bisnis, baik di tingkat individu maupun perusahaan. Lalu, apa sebenarnya cloud computing dan bagaimana teknologi terbarunya memengaruhi dunia digital kita? Apa Itu Cloud Computing? Cloud computing adalah model penyampaian layanan komputasi melalui internet. Alih-alih menyimpan data di perangkat keras lokal, cloud computing memungkinkan kita untuk menyimpan, mengakses, dan mengelola data serta aplikasi melalui server jarak jauh yang dikelola oleh penyedia layanan cloud. Hal ini memungkinkan pengguna untuk mengakses informasi dan aplikasi mereka dari mana saja, tanpa terbatas oleh lokasi fisik perangkat. Ada tiga jenis utama layanan dalam cloud computing: Infrastructure as a Service ...

Mengenal IT Enterprise: Fondasi Teknologi untuk Bisnis

IT Enterprise adalah sekumpulan teknologi dan sistem yang dirancang untuk mendukung kebutuhan bisnis besar atau perusahaan. Berbeda dengan IT pribadi atau IT skala kecil, IT Enterprise mencakup solusi kompleks yang digunakan oleh perusahaan untuk mengelola operasi bisnis, mengoptimalkan efisiensi, serta menjaga data dan layanan tetap aman. 1. Apa Itu IT Enterprise? IT Enterprise adalah infrastruktur teknologi yang memungkinkan perusahaan mengelola dan memantau proses bisnis secara efisien. Teknologi ini digunakan dalam berbagai aktivitas, mulai dari mengelola sumber daya manusia, keuangan, produksi, hingga layanan pelanggan. Komponen utama dalam IT Enterprise biasanya meliputi: Sistem Manajemen Database: Digunakan untuk menyimpan dan mengelola data penting perusahaan. Aplikasi Bisnis: Seperti perangkat lunak ERP (Enterprise Resource Planning) dan CRM (Customer Relationship Management). Keamanan IT: Proteksi data dan jaringan terhadap ancaman eksternal. 2. Manfaat IT Enterprise bagi...